A traffic collision was reported on northbound State Route 99 at the Ashlan Avenue off-ramp in California, according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records. The incident was logged at 9:28 a.m. on Aug. 22.
Dispatch listed the injury status as unknown, with no confirmation of severity or how many people may have been hurt. The record also did not specify how many vehicles were involved or what led to the crash.

California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
